Crossmead Hall was acquired in 1944. The pond at the hall of residence was dredged each summer and used by the students as a swimming pool. Crossmead residents were known as Jentlemen as they travelled to and from campus on Exeter's J bus.
'C-R-O-S-S-M-E-A-D!
C-R-O-S-S-M-E-A-D!
Crossmead, way up on Dunsford Hill
Where social life is nil,
An ever rising bill,
Way up on Duns---ford Hill.
J for Gentlemen
Jentlemen, Jentle, Jentle, Jentlemen.'
The Crossmead Hall song.

Photograph of the exterior of the Registry of the University College of the South West, damaged in the Exeter Blitz in May 1942. Most of the college records were also destroyed.
